Paula Deen’s ooey gooey butter cake delivers a rich, creamy dessert that combines sweet cream cheese and buttery cake layers. Southern bakers and dessert enthusiasts cherish this indulgent treat for its simple ingredients and irresistible texture.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 (18.25 oz / 517 g) yellow cake mix
- 1 (8 oz / 227 g) cream cheese, softened
- 1 (16 oz / 454 g) powdered sugar
- 16 tbsps (1 cup / 227 g) butter, melted
- 3 eggs
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
Instructions
- Cake Base Creation: Blend yellow cake mix, egg, and melted butter into a crumbly mixture. Press firmly and evenly across the bottom of a greased 13×9-inch baking dish, forming a compact foundational layer.
- Cream Cheese Topping Preparation: Whip softened cream cheese until silky smooth. Incorporate eggs, vanilla extract, and melted butter, blending until fully integrated and uniform in texture.
- Sugar Integration: Fold powdered sugar into the cream cheese mixture, ensuring a velvety, lump-free consistency that promises a decadent topping experience.
- Layer Assembly: Distribute the cream cheese mixture uniformly over the cake base, creating a seamless, even coating that covers the entire surface.
- Baking and Finishing: Place in a preheated oven at 350°F and bake for 40-50 minutes. Look for a slightly gooey center and golden-brown edges, indicating perfect doneness. Remove and cool completely at room temperature to allow layers to set and flavors to meld.
Notes
- Master the Base Texture: Press the cake mix layer firmly and evenly to create a solid, compact foundation that provides structural support for the creamy topping.
- Prevent Cream Cheese Lumps: Beat cream cheese thoroughly and sift powdered sugar to ensure a silky-smooth, lump-free topping that melts in your mouth.
- Watch Baking Precision: Monitor the oven closely during the 40-50 minute baking time; the perfect moment is when edges turn golden and center remains slightly gooey.
- Cool for Ultimate Flavor: Let the cake rest completely at room temperature to allow layers to set and flavors to meld, enhancing the dessert’s rich, decadent profile.
